No dice

I asked again and it seems they consider that CMB-BKK // NRT-LHR as two seperate stopovers (BKK and NRT) which means that all other "stops" within Asia have to be within the 24 hour transit period.

As they don't count BKK-NRT surface as one of the "4 allowed sectors within continent of origin" I - in my self-interested view - don't think a surface sector should be considered a second stop but it's not me who issues the ticket .

I wouldn't say it is 100% the definitive answer - nothing I could see in the rules either way - so each office and airline may have a different interpretation......
